About Zum:
Zum is a rapidly expanding Series E startup backed by industry leaders Sequoia Capital, Soft Bank, Spark Capital, and GIC, with a bold mission to transform the stagnant school transportation industry. Operating in over 15 states across the United States—with flagship hubs in San Francisco, Los Angeles, and Seattle—we are actively extending our reach to the East Coast and Midwest regions.
As a technology-driven company, we deploy cutting-edge solutions to manage and operate school district transportation systems while also launching our own charter platform and developing proprietary SaaS offerings. Additionally, we are spearheading a nationwide initiative to electrify school transportation fleets, simultaneously supporting local utilities by feeding much-needed energy back into the grid. We have been recognized as CNBC 50 disruptor, Financial Times 500 fastest growing companies, Fast Company World Changing Ideas.
This position is 100% remote based and will require early morning support for our east coast bus yards. The role also requires 20% travel.
Who You Are:We are seeking a proactive and customer‑focused IT Analyst to join our IT team operating out of the East Coast. Reporting to our Head of IT, the ideal candidate will provide hands‑on technical support, manage IT assets, and ensure the smooth operation of daily technology needs across the organization. They will also serve as the primary on‑call support technician for our east coast bus yards.
This position requires strong troubleshooting skills, a service‑oriented mindset, and the ability to support a variety of platforms and systems.
